Judge David Bunning has ordered Davis and all of her deputy clerks to appear before him tomorrow at 11 AM. He will be determining if Davis is in contempt of court for refusing his order to begin issuing marriage licenses to LGBT couples. My guess is that he's requiring the deputy clerks to be there for a reason. He wants them to know that they may be liable for penalties if they refuse to issue licenses. And they may get to see an object lesson if he orders Kim Davis jailed or imposes fines on her.
Also, Davis is an elected official and can't be fired. The deputy clerks are not elected. They can lose their jobs for not performing their duties. Judge Bunning may remind them of that fact.
